Impact of Tourism on Hotel Occupancy Rates

The relationship between tourism and hotel occupancy rates is an essential aspect of understanding Canada’s hospitality landscape. High tourist influx directly correlates with increased occupancy rates, leading to thriving hotel businesses. Several factors influence this dynamic, including seasonal trends, local events, and international travel patterns.The following statistics provide insight into the occupancy rates and popular destinations in Canada:

  • In 2019, prior to the pandemic, Canada’s hotel occupancy rate averaged approximately 67.1%.
  • Post-pandemic data indicates a gradual recovery, with certain regions reaching 70% occupancy during peak travel seasons in 2022.
  • Tourist hotspots like Banff and Jasper experience peak occupancy rates exceeding 90% during the summer months.
  • Winter activities, particularly in ski resorts in British Columbia and Alberta, see occupancy rates climbing as high as 95% during the ski season.

Toronto

Toronto, as Canada’s largest city, is a hub for travelers seeking a vibrant urban experience. The city’s hotels range from opulent skyscrapers to charming boutique spots nestled in cultural districts. The central business district, known as the Financial District, features several high-end options, while neighborhoods like Queen West and Kensington Market showcase smaller, unique hotels that reflect the city’s eclectic spirit.

Here are some of the best hotels in Toronto:

  • Four Seasons Hotel Toronto
    -A luxury oasis with spacious rooms, world-class dining, and a renowned spa, located in the upscale Yorkville district.
  • Shangri-La Hotel Toronto
    -Offers a blend of Asian hospitality and Canadian culture, with lavish rooms and an impressive art collection.
  • The Drake Hotel
    -A trendy boutique hotel known for its artistic vibe, rooftop patio, and a vibrant bar scene.
  • Hotel Le Germain Toronto
    -Combines modern luxury with a warm atmosphere, ideal for both business and leisure travelers.

Vancouver

Vancouver is renowned for its stunning natural beauty and cosmopolitan lifestyle. The city’s hospitality scene reflects its surroundings, with many hotels featuring breathtaking views of the mountains and ocean. From luxury accommodations in downtown to charming boutique hotels in historic neighborhoods like Gastown, there’s something for everyone. Top hotels in Vancouver include:

  • Fairmont Pacific Rim
    -A luxury hotel featuring stunning waterfront views, sophisticated dining, and a renowned spa.
  • Shangri-La Hotel Vancouver
    -Offers spacious rooms with views of the city skyline and the North Shore mountains, along with a luxurious wellness center.
  • Hotel Georgia
    -A historic hotel that seamlessly blends classic elegance with contemporary design, located in the heart of downtown.
  • The Listel Hotel Vancouver
    -A boutique hotel known for its art focus, locally sourced cuisine, and proximity to cultural amenities.

Montreal

With its blend of European charm and North American vibrancy, Montreal is a city that offers an array of hotel accommodations. The city’s hotels range from luxurious historic properties to modern boutique establishments, often reflecting the city’s rich art and culture. The Old Montreal district is particularly popular among visitors, featuring hotels that are steeped in history and character.Here are some notable hotels in Montreal:

  • Hotel Le St-James
    -A luxury hotel set in a historic building, offering opulent interiors and an acclaimed restaurant.
  • W Montreal
    -Known for its contemporary design and vibrant nightlife, this hotel is located near the bustling Place des Arts.
  • Hotel Nelligan
    -A charming boutique hotel in Old Montreal with elegant rooms and a rooftop terrace boasting stunning views.
  • Fairmont The Queen Elizabeth
    -An iconic hotel located above the central train station, offering a mix of luxury and convenience.

Examples of Unique Hotels

Below is a selection of some of the most fascinating unique hotels across Canada, showcasing their standout features and pricing. Each of these accommodations offers something special that enhances the guest experience, making them worthy of exploration:

Hotel Name Location Features Price Range (per night)
Hotel de Glace Quebec City, QC Ice hotel, themed suites, and ice bar. $200 – $400
Free Spirit Spheres Vancouver Island, BC Treehouse accommodations, nestled in the forest, eco-friendly. $150 – $250
Fogo Island Inn Fogo Island, NL Stunning architecture, local art, and ocean views. $500 – $800
The Wigwam Motel Southwestern Ontario Iconic teepee-shaped rooms, retro vibe. $100 – $150
Clayoquot Wilderness Resort Vancouver Island, BC Luxury tents, wildlife experiences, and gourmet dining. $700 – $1,200

Seasonal Attractions Impacting Hotel Bookings

Several seasonal attractions significantly influence hotel bookings throughout the year. Here’s a look at some of the key events and natural phenomena that drive travelers to popular destinations:

  • Winter Ski Season: Popular ski resorts such as Whistler and Banff attract visitors from December to March, with winter sports and festive activities.
  • Spring Festivals: From tulip festivals in Ottawa to cherry blossom viewings in Vancouver, spring draws crowds from April to June.
  • Summer Tourism: Long days and warm weather from June to August are ideal for outdoor activities, festivals, and national park visits, leading to high demand for accommodations.
  • Fall Foliage: The stunning autumn colors in regions like Ontario and Quebec make September to October a popular time for leaf-peeping tours and drives.
  • Holiday Celebrations: December sees an influx of visitors for Christmas markets and winter festivals, notably in cities like Toronto and Montreal.

These seasonal attractions not only enhance the travel experience but also directly influence hotel availability and pricing, making it crucial for travelers to be mindful of these factors when planning their trips.

Reliable Platforms for Hotel Reviews

When evaluating hotel reviews, it’s essential to refer to platforms that are known for their credibility and thorough review processes. Here are some of the most trusted sources:

  • Tripadvisor: This platform aggregates reviews from millions of travelers, employing a proprietary algorithm that ensures the authenticity of user-generated content. They also provide a “trust score” to help users assess the overall sentiment of the reviews.
  • Booking.com: Reviews on Booking.com are submitted only by verified guests, ensuring that feedback is genuine. Their rating system considers various factors, including cleanliness, comfort, and location.
  • Google Reviews: With its vast user base, Google provides a straightforward rating system that combines both qualitative and quantitative assessments, allowing users to see ratings alongside helpful comments.
  • Yelp: Although primarily known for restaurant reviews, Yelp has a substantial presence in the hotel sector. Their review verification process includes checks for suspicious patterns or behavior to maintain integrity.

Evaluating Hotel Reviews

When reading reviews, certain aspects can help travelers discern their value effectively:

  • Check the dates: Recent reviews are more relevant for understanding the current state of the hotel. An establishment can undergo significant changes over time, so prioritize recent feedback.
  • Diverse perspectives: Look for reviews that cover various aspects of the stay. This includes service, facilities, noise levels, and food quality. A well-rounded set of insights aids in forming a complete picture.
  • Beware of outliers: While a single negative review may raise a red flag, understanding the context is key. Look for patterns in the feedback rather than being swayed by one-off experiences.
  • Pay attention to responses: How management responds to reviews can also be telling. A hotel that actively engages with customers and addresses complaints shows a commitment to service.
